• DocumentCode
    393078
  • Title

    An efficient implementation for broadcasting data in parallel applications over Ethernet clusters

  • Author

    Tinetti, Fernando G. ; Barbieri, Andrés

  • fYear
    2003
  • fDate
    27-29 March 2003
  • Firstpage
    593
  • Lastpage
    596
  • Abstract
    This paper introduces a natural implementation for broadcasting data on Ethernet based clusters used for parallel computing. Initially, it will be shown that libraries for Message Passing between processes such as PVM and implementations of MPI do not implement efficiently this operation or there is no reliability in terms of its performance. An implementation for broadcast messages is presented, taking into account the Ethernet based hardware layer found in most of the clusters used for parallel computing. The proposed implementation for broadcasting data is compared with the broadcast message available in PVM and LAM/MPI. Also, some comments are made about the proposed broadcast messages when the hardware layer is not Ethernet based. Finally, it will be shown by experimentation how the proposed broadcast message is used in the context of parallel linear algebra operations, specifically for parallel matrix multiplication.
  • Keywords
    local area networks; message passing; parallel algorithms; workstation clusters; Ethernet based clusters; Message Passing; cluster computing; networks of workstations; parallel algorithms; parallel computing; parallel linear algebra; parallel matrix multiplication; Application software; Broadcasting; Concurrent computing; Ethernet networks; Hardware; Libraries; Message passing; Parallel algorithms; Parallel processing; Workstations;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Advanced Information Networking and Applications, 2003. AINA 2003. 17th International Conference on
  • Print_ISBN
    0-7695-1906-7
  • Type

    conf

  • DOI
    10.1109/AINA.2003.1192951
  • Filename
    1192951